THE FLORIDA BAR v. CARSON

No. 91,550.

737 So.2d 1069 (1999)

THE FLORIDA BAR, Complainant, v. Kevin Kitpatrick CARSON, Respondent.

Supreme Court of Florida.

Rehearing Denied August 16, 1999.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

John F. Harkness, Jr., Executive Director, and John Anthony Boggs, Staff Counsel, Tallahassee, Florida, and Patricia Ann Toro Savitz, Bar Counsel, Orlando, Florida, for Complainant.

Kevin Kitpatrick Carson, pro se, Daytona Beach, Florida, for Respondent.


PER CURIAM.

We have for review a referee's report regarding alleged ethical breaches by Kevin Kitpatrick Carson. After two hearings, the referee recommended that Carson be diverted to a practice and professionalism enhancement program pursuant to rule 3-5.3 of the Rules Regulating The Florida Bar and that Carson be required to pay the costs of the disciplinary proceedings. We have jurisdiction. See art. V, § 15, Fla. Const.
